In the end I wanted to select something that I thought would inspire something that translates well into photography. So I chose Grant Wood, famous for the American Gothic image. He has a grainy texture to his work, stark images of people, and farm life. He also has some amazing lithographs. (In truth, I also selected him because he's from Iowa, not too far from me in Illinois...he went to the Art Institute of Chicago and I'm living near there...and I've seen American Gothic at the Art Institute of Chicago several times...a little local shout out).
